Summers focusing on five

One of the nation's finest running backs has zeroed
in on five teams heading into the home stretch of his recruitment.
Advertisement
"Right now I'm mainly looking at South Carolina,
Florida, Tennessee, Miami and Florida State," said Lexington (S.C.) product
Demetris Summers, the top player in the Palmetto State, a
member of the
Rivals100 team and the No. 3
rated running back in the nation. "I don't have my officials set, but I'm
getting closer."
Clemson had previously been in Summers' top five,
but have since "slipped off a little bit," he said.
Meanwhile, the Tigers' archrival, South Carolina, is
thought to still hold the driver's seat in his recruitment.
"Yeah, I like them a whole lot," said Summers, whose
family lives 15 minutes away from the USC campus. "But I don't know if I'd
say they're No. 1 right now. All those other teams are making it a hard
decision. They have me thinking about them a lot."
Another team, Oklahoma, had been starting to show
interest in October, but Summers said he's yet to hear back from the
Sooners. "I just had that one call," he said. "I was kind of interested
then, but not so much now."
As a junior, Summers established himself as one of
the nation's top prospects by rushing for a whopping 2,329 yards and 39
touchdowns. He's rushed for more than 8,000 yards and averaged close to 10
yards per carry in his career at Lexington.
